JASDF F-2 loses drop tanks off Guam

Citing broadcaster NHK, Japan Security Watch has said that a Japan Air Self-Defense Force Mitsubishi F-2 fighter inadvertently dropped two of its external fuel tanks into the Pacific Ocean off Guam on February 16th.

The F-2 was conducting a joint exercise based out of Guam (almost certainly Ex. Cope North) when the incident happened. Both tanks were seen falling into the ocean and there were no reports of damage and/or casualties. Other press reports have cited human error as the cause of this case, which I am presuming to mean the stores jettison switch was accidentally activated, causing the tanks to drop off the aircraft.

The Mitsubishi F-2 is capable of carrying two 600 US gallon (2271 litre) tanks in it's wings.
